Output d9683ad4039bf56bede84b34d0e49cf211fcc017bbbe013a683ebfc8924f89ec:41

value
615968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8564ca9f39fe379b65cc2bf78737e9a7db6d8d5 OP_EQUALVERIFY OP_CHECKSIG
address
1Pe5xmSDyozv7415ZNfUwaiXUnTBMRBjp8
transaction
d9683ad4039bf56bede84b34d0e49cf211fcc017bbbe013a683ebfc8924f89ec
confirmations
280687
spent
true